When crooner Guy Lambert wraps his London show and travels to Brussels, two beauties secretly follow. One (Annette Day) is a lovestruck heiress, the other (Yvonne Romain) is an enigmatic temptress. And they could be too much for unattached Guy.
Comedy, mystery and mayhem combine when Elvis Presley plays Guy in "Double Trouble," a romp involving stolen gems, trench-coated defectives--that is, detectives!--and more. Through it all, a guy's gotta do what a guy's gotta do. That means performing a tune array that includes the title cut, "City By Night," and "Could I Fall in Love?" "Long Legged Girl" and "There's So Much World to See." Trouble was never this cool and this much fun.
